Description:

Recently, the Federal Trade Commission implemented regulations to prevent and mitigate the growing identity theft problem in our society. In Part I of his Red Flags Rules series, identity theft expert Yan Ross examines the FTC’s role in policing identity theft and discusses the principal provisions of the Red Flags Rules. Talking points include the history and development of the new legislation and the practical implications of compliance with the rules, and penalties for non-compliance. Blending detailed analysis, keen insight, and decades of experience in the field, Mr. Ross equips attorneys with the right tools to help clients and customers avoid falling prey to this serious and prevalent crime.

Mr. Ross's present objective is to help re-focus current efforts to combat identity theft from a "war of attrition" to a victim reduction posture. The principal elements of this approach are education and the generation of "actionable information." These elements are conducted in three areas:
    * Consumer [including high-school and adult] education on identity theft prevention, through live and online training as well as software-based disciplines.
    * Integrated case management tracking of identity theft incidents, among law enforcement, prosecution, regulatory, and private sector entities; the ability to discern patterns and link together the facts of large numbers of cases can lead to more effective prevention and prosecution [only about 5% of identity theft cases are now prosecuted].
    * Assisting public and private sector holders of protected information in complying with their responsibilities to maintain the security and confidentiality of such information.
